ICD-10-CMThis code signifies a long-term complication or residual effect stemming from a burn injury of unknown severity to an unspecified area of the thigh. It indicates that the acute burn has healed, but the patient is experiencing ongoing issues directly attributable to that past injury.
Apply this code when documenting conditions such as scarring, contractures, chronic pain, or nerve damage that are a direct result of a previous burn to the thigh, where the original burn's degree was not specified. This code is appropriate for encounters addressing these persistent sequelae after the initial burn treatment is complete.
